Doom3 (and I believe CoD) use Safedisc 3.20 which doesn't have a problem working from the virtual drive. The SecuROM blacklist should be fixed in the next version as NARS said. If you are having issues running Doom3 from the Virtual Drive, try reinstalling Alcohol and changing the driver names.

Uninstall CloneCD to make Doom3 and COD go in the VD as SafeDisc 3.20 blacklists CloneCD.
